Culturism (cŭl-ch́әr-ĭź-әm) n. 1. The philosophy, science and art of managing and protecting majority cultures. 2. A philosophy which holds that majority cultures have the right to define, protect and promote themselves. 3. The study of culturism.

 

Mul·ti·cul·tur·al·ism (mŭl-tē-kŭl-chәr-әl-ĭź-әm) n. 1. Of or relating to a social or educational theory that encourages interest in many cultures within a society rather than in only a mainstream culture.
